NEW-DELHI: In a Significant Development, Russian President Vladimir Putin engaged in a telephone conversation with Prime Minister Narendra Modi. The conversation covered a range of topics, including President Putin's regrettable unavailability for the upcoming G-20 summit scheduled to take place in Delhi next month. Instead, Russia will be represented by Sergey Lavrov at the conference.

Sources indicate that during the conversation, both leaders engaged in a comprehensive review of ongoing bilateral cooperation efforts. They also delved into discussions on pertinent regional and global matters of mutual interest. The dialogue encompassed insights into the recently concluded 15th BRICS Summit in Johannesburg.

A Notable highlight of the conversation was President Putin's acknowledgment and congratulations to Prime Minister Modi on the successful landing of Chandrayaan-3, a significant milestone in India's lunar exploration endeavors.  Both sides reaffirmed their commitment to maintaining a robust and close dialogue. This commitment is particularly relevant in the context of Russia's forthcoming BRICS chairmanship, set to commence on January 1, 2024.
